在Go语言中,结构体指针切片是一种常见且高效的数据组织方式,尤其适用于需要修改原始数据或避免值拷贝的场景。
编译器通常通过生成额外的元数据(而不是运行时代码)来描述可能抛出异常的区域和对应的catch块位置。
这简直是自寻死路。
这意味着csv.DictReader的迭代器本身就返回字典对象,而不是简单的字符串列表。
通过 channel 将结果传回,避免竞态条件。
return 0;}注意:同时引入两个包含同名函数的命名空间可能导致调用歧义。
然而,在某些分析场景下,我们可能需要将不同聚合函数的结果以行(row-wise)的形式展示,即每一行代表一个聚合函数(如最小值、最大值),而列则对应原始DataFrame的列。
算法选择: 不同的算法对不同的因素敏感程度不同。
基本上就这些。
仔细查阅您要使用的Google API的文档,了解所需的具体scope。
url_for('static', filename=new_image_filename): 这是生成静态文件URL的关键。
go get ./...: 获取当前项目所有依赖。
6. 总结 当PHP文件上传到服务器成功但数据库记录失败时,核心问题通常在于SQL查询的构建或执行。
这种做法不仅效率低下,增加了邮件服务器的负担,也可能因频繁发送邮件而降低用户体验,甚至被误判为垃圾邮件。
说实话,std::move 这个名字取得有点“误导性”。
将具体类型赋值给 interface{} 很简单: var data interface{} = 42 data = "hello" data = true 从 interface{} 取出原始类型需要类型断言或类型开关。
XSLT通过document()函数实现多XML文档合并,可结合变量、条件语句动态加载文件,支持命名空间处理、数据排序与过滤,灵活生成所需格式的整合结果。
通过理解.和..的含义,并在PHP的文件系统操作中正确地过滤它们,我们可以编写出更健壮、更可靠、更符合预期的代码。
考虑以下两种常见的Python代码模式:# 模式一:先赋值,后使用 variable = expression func(variable) # 模式二:直接使用表达式作为参数 func(expression)从内存分配的角度来看,这两种模式在计算 expression 的值时,其内存占用是几乎相同的。
比如,你有一个用户操作日志列表,去重后你还想知道用户第一次执行某个操作的顺序,那么set()就无法满足你的需求了。
本文链接:http://www.2laura.com/325214_637a7d.html